Rwanda is home to several incredible national parks, including Volcanoes National Park, renowned for its gorilla trekking, Nyungwe Forest National Park, famous for its chimpanzees and rich biodiversity, and Akagera National Park, where you can witness the Big Five amidst scenic savannahs. Alongside gorillas, tourists can expect to see golden monkeys, elephants, lions, and over 700 bird species.

Frequently Asked Questions

Why choose Rwanda for a safari?
Rwanda is best known for luxury gorilla trekking experiences and exceptional conservation standards. It offers a refined, intimate safari experience with short travel distances and high-quality lodges.
What is Rwanda most famous for?

Rwanda is world-famous for mountain gorilla trekking in Volcanoes National Park, one of the few places on earth where you can see gorillas in the wild.

Is gorilla trekking the only safari experience in Rwanda?
Rwanda also offers classic game viewing in Akagera National Park, chimpanzee tracking in Nyungwe Forest, scenic lakes, and cultural experiences, making it more than just a gorilla destination.
When is the best time to visit Rwanda?
Rwanda is a year-round destination. The best trekking conditions are during the drier months from June to September and December to February.
How long should a Rwanda safari be?
Most Rwanda safaris last three to seven days, depending on whether you focus solely on gorilla trekking or combine it with wildlife, forest walks, or a neighboring country.
How difficult is gorilla trekking?
Gorilla trekking can be moderately challenging, depending on the gorilla family’s location. Treks can last between one and five hours, but porters are available to assist.
Can Rwanda safaris be combined with other countries?
Rwanda is often combined with Kenya or Tanzania for a classic safari, or with Uganda for additional gorilla or chimpanzee trekking.
How much does a Rwanda safari cost?
Rwanda safaris are generally high-end due to conservation fees and gorilla permits. Costs depend on accommodation choice, number of trekking days, and travel season.
Do I need a permit for gorilla trekking?
A gorilla trekking permit is required and must be secured in advance. Permit availability is limited, especially during peak season.
Can Rwanda safaris be customized?
Rwanda safaris are tailor-made based on your interests, schedule, and budget, whether you want a luxury gorilla trek or a broader nature-focused itinerary.
How does Rwanda compare to Uganda for gorilla trekking?
Rwanda offers shorter travel times and more luxury lodge options, while Uganda generally offers lower permit costs and longer trekking experiences. Both provide exceptional gorilla encounters.
